Appsecure logo

CVE-2026-22864: High Vulnerability in Deno

A high-severity vulnerability affecting Deno versions prior to 2.5.6 allows attackers to bypass security checks against Windows batch file execution. Organizations should prioritize patching to mitigate potential risks.

HIGHCVSS 8.1 · Published January 15, 2026

Not a customer? See how AppSecure simulates real world attacks to protect your infrastructure.

Speak to Experts

Deno, a runtime for JavaScript, TypeScript, and WebAssembly, has a critical vulnerability identified as CVE-2026-22864. This vulnerability allows attackers to bypass security measures intended to block the execution of Windows batch files. Specifically, prior to version 2.5.6, Deno’s check for file extensions was case-sensitive, enabling attackers to exploit the system by using alternative casing (e.g., .BAT, .Bat) for malicious files. The vulnerability is classified as high severity with a CVSS score of 8.1, indicating significant risk.

The implications of this vulnerability are severe as it provides attackers with the capability to execute arbitrary commands on affected systems. This could lead to unauthorized access, data breaches, and compromised system integrity. Given the nature of Deno's usage in web applications, the potential for exploitation is a critical concern for organizations relying on this runtime.

Organizations should prioritize patching immediately to version 2.5.6 or later to mitigate this risk. The vulnerability was publicly disclosed on January 15, 2026, and has been addressed in the subsequent release.

In conclusion, the urgency of addressing CVE-2026-22864 cannot be overstated. The potential impacts on confidentiality, integrity, and availability of systems are considerable, making immediate remediation essential.

Vulnerability Details

Deno is a JavaScript, TypeScript, and WebAssembly runtime. Before 2.5.6, a prior patch aimed to block spawning Windows batch/shell files by returning an error when a spawned path’s extension matched .bat or .cmd. That check performs a case-sensitive comparison against lowercase literals and therefore can be bypassed when the extension uses alternate casing (for example .BAT, .Bat, etc.). This vulnerability is fixed in 2.5.6.

The CVSS score for this vulnerability is 8.1, classified as high severity. It allows attackers to exploit systems over a network, with a high attack complexity and no privileges required. The impacts of this vulnerability on confidentiality, integrity, and availability are all rated as high.

The affected product is Deno, with all versions prior to 2.5.6 being vulnerable. The vulnerability was published on January 15, 2026.

Technical Analysis

The root cause of this vulnerability lies in the case-sensitive comparison used to validate file extensions in Deno. Attackers may leverage this flaw to execute malicious scripts disguised as benign files by utilizing variations in file extension casing.

The attack vector is network-based, allowing remote exploitation without the need for user interaction. The attack complexity is rated as high, suggesting that successful exploitation may require specific conditions or knowledge of the system's configuration.

No privileges are required to exploit this vulnerability, making it accessible to any unauthorized user. This enhances the risk potential significantly. The impacts on confidentiality, integrity, and availability of affected systems are all rated as high, indicating the serious nature of this vulnerability.

Risk & Impact Analysis

Organizations utilizing Deno in production environments face considerable risk due to CVE-2026-22864. The potential for attackers to execute arbitrary commands increases the likelihood of data breaches, unauthorized access, and system integrity compromise. The blast radius of this vulnerability can extend beyond the initial point of exploitation, affecting interconnected systems and services.

Given the CVSS score of 8.1, immediate attention and action are warranted. Organizations should assess their exposure to this vulnerability and implement remediation strategies as part of their security posture.

The urgency for remediation is critical, as the potential for exploitation exists until systems are patched. Organizations should prioritize this in their patch management cycles.

Exploitation Status

Signal

Status

Known Exploit

No

Public PoC

No

Actively Exploited

No

Ransomware Use

No

Affected Versions

The vulnerability affects Deno versions prior to 2.5.6. It is critical for users to upgrade to this version or later to ensure the security of their systems.

Mitigation & Remediation

Organizations should update Deno to version 2.5.6 or later to address this vulnerability. For those unable to upgrade immediately, consider implementing configuration hardening measures to restrict the execution of potentially malicious file types.

Additionally, organizations can utilize penetration testing services to identify potential vulnerabilities in their applications.

Detection Guidance

To detect potential exploitation attempts, organizations should monitor logs for unusual patterns of file execution, particularly those involving batch file extensions. Additionally, behavioral anomalies related to unexpected script executions should be investigated.

AppSecure Threat Intelligence Insight

The long-term significance of CVE-2026-22864 highlights the importance of comprehensive security measures in modern runtimes like Deno. As vulnerabilities evolve, security teams must remain vigilant and proactive in addressing potential threats.

This case exemplifies the necessity of robust validation mechanisms against user inputs and system commands. Organizations should consider this an opportunity to review their security protocols and invest in vulnerability management programs to fortify their defenses against similar threats.

As organizations continue to integrate technologies like Deno into their workflows, understanding the security landscape will be critical. Regular assessments and updates, along with awareness of emerging vulnerabilities, can significantly reduce risk exposure.

Ultimately, this vulnerability serves as a reminder of the evolving nature of threats within the software ecosystem, necessitating continual adaptation and improvement of security practices.

For further insights on securing web applications, organizations may refer to resources on web application penetration testing and ongoing security assessments.

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

Latest CVEs. Recently published vulnerabilities from the NVD database.

View all vulnerabilities
CVE IDSeverity
CVE-2025-65418HIGH
CVE-2025-65417MEDIUM
CVE-2025-65416MEDIUM
CVE-2025-65415MEDIUM
CVE-2025-61314HIGH

Protect Your Business with Hacker-Focused Approach.